"Poop On 2020 Simulator" is a humorous game that allows players to relieve stress by pooping on various 2020-themed items such as politicians, viruses, and toilet paper rolls. The game features simple mechanics and a variety of objects to defecate on, providing a lighthearted escape from the challenges of the year. Despite its crude humor, the game has received generally positive reviews on Steam.



- The game provides a hilarious and cathartic experience, allowing players to vent their frustrations about the challenging years of 2020 and 2021.
- The sound effects and soft-body physics are praised as top-notch, adding to the overall enjoyment and humor of the game.
- With a perfect price point and numerous achievements to unlock, it offers great value for those who appreciate silly humor and light-hearted gameplay.
- The gameplay is very short, with some players completing it in just a few minutes, leading to concerns about replayability.
- While the humor is appreciated, it may not appeal to everyone, particularly those who do not enjoy bathroom humor.
- Some players have expressed frustration with specific achievements that are difficult to unlock, which can detract from the overall experience.
